Mr. Raptor Man, Sir, please provide evidence that Global Warming is a natural effect.

To show causality here in the science world, we need a few things:

1) We need something that when you increase it, the temperature increases.
2) We need something that when you decrease it, the temperature decreases.
3) We need to remove other contributing factors and make sure that the relationship still exists.

So, if it's caused by nature, I'll need you to provide me with data that correlates biomass to temperature (here's a hint as to why you'll fail with that one; the Earth is currently more deforested than it has ever been, habitats are shrinking faster than they have ever been, and the number of species going extinct in comparable to the mass extinction that killed the Dinosaurs; after that one, the temperature went down, not up).

That evidence appears to indicate that global warming is not solely due to nature.

Now let's talk about removing mitigating factors; that would be man. In order for you to prove that it's not man-caused, you'll have to get rid of man-made emissions, because they're definitely affecting your data.

As for "man-made", here's some information for you. Your position relies on the assumption that greenhouse gas levels in the atmosphere are static; in fact, these gases are in constant flux and without human sources of CO2, plant life would be sufficient to maintain the temperature at a healthy rate of change (i.e. one that will cause gradual weather changes and sea level increases, then recycle that into decreases). Generally, animal populations are at an equilibrium of not increasing, and so their emissions don't increase, so the *amount* of greenhouse gases does not go up because plants maintain it.

There are problems happening right now with this system:

1) We are cutting down forests like never before, decreasing the earth's ability to deal with CO2 and maintain balance.
2) We are killing animals like never before, which *should* decrease the temperature. All it's doing is decreasing the share of CO2 that animals make.
2) We are burning fossil fuels like never before, making man the only source that increases its CO2 output.

Other sources like water vapor, ozone, etc, are still at a relative equilibrium and so we're okay.
